What mass of a 4.00% NaOH solution by mass contains 15.0 g of NaOH?

Answer:

375 grams of 4% NaOH solution contains 15 grams NaOH

Explanation:

Given 4% solution of NaOH = 4g NaOH/100 g Solution

=> 4g NaOH/100g Soln = 15 g NaOH / X

=> X = 15 g NaOH (100 g Soln) / 4 g NaOH = 375 grams Soln contains 15 g NaOH.
